The leÂgal batÂtle beÂtween forÂmer FiÂnance MinÂisÂter Colm ImÂbert and AuÂdiÂtor GenÂerÂal JaiÂwantie RamÂdass—deÂscribed as a “comÂmuÂniÂcaÂtion isÂsue” by his sucÂcesÂsor, SenÂaÂtor VishÂnu DhanÂpaul—is set to cost the State more than $2 milÂlion.
